Cereal And Seed Mixture

Low concern

Generic compound term; nutritional profile depends on specific cereals (wheat, oats, rye) and seeds (sunflower, sesame, pumpkin, flax). May contain gluten (wheat/rye) and tree-nut/seed allergens (sesame).

What it is

Generic umbrella term for a blend of cereal grains and seeds.

Multigrain inclusion in bread, snacks, and cereals.

Why it's flagged

What regulators actually say

"Sesame is the 9th major food allergen recognized by the United States. The change became effective on January 1, 2023."

Regulatory status

United States — FDA

Composite food; allergen labeling under FALCPA/FASTER Act

European Union — EFSA

Composite food; allergen labeling under EU 1169/2011
